ABOUT SIX MONTHS PHP TRAINING

PHP stands for PHP Hypertext Preprocessor. "PHP is an HTML-embedded scripting language. Aedifico Tech provides Core PHP and My SQL training according to the current requirement of IT industry. The goal of the language is to allow web developers to write dynamically generated pages quickly. It can be composed with HTML, or with other templating engines and web frameworks. In order to create dynamic web pages developers use PHP language .PHP language has most of the syntax derived from languages such as C, PERL, and Java.

Our course on Core PHP starts with introduction to HTML, CSS, PHP, MySQL and covers almost everything needed to get a firm grasp on this fastest growing server scripting language. This course is spread over 6 weeks and by the end of it, a student shall be able to create a fully functional script using core PHP.

Course Highlights

  • Session- I
    Introduction to PHP
    PHP Installation.
    Variables, Statements, Operators
    Control Statements.
    Conditional Statements
    Lab Ex1: For if, if-else and if- else if condition
    Lab Ex2: For Switch condition
    Looping Statements
    Lab Ex3: For for Loop
    Lab Ex4: For While Loop
    Lab Ex5: For Do - While Loop
    Session – II

    Arrays and Functions

    Types of Arrays (Numeric, Associative and Multidimensional)
    Lab Ex1: For Declaration, Storing and retrieving data from Numeric Arrays
    Lab Ex2: For Declaration, Storing and retrieving data from Associative Arrays
    Lab Ex3: For Declaration, Storing and retrieving data from Multidimensional Arrays
    Types of Functions (User Defined and System Defined)
    Lab Ex4: For User Defined function Definition and Calling
    ab Ex5: For Arguments Passing as Call by References and Call by value
    Lab Ex6: Include/Import/Require function for loading external Defined function
    Session- III

    Classes and Objects.

    Introduction of Class, Declaration
    Lab Ex1: For Student Class Declaration with properties and functions Objects, Accessing Class properties, functions using the objects
    Lab Ex2: For Creating Objects and accessing Class properties and functions Inheritance & Function Overloading
    Lab Ex3: For Creating child class and inherit the parent class properties and functions
    comming soon
    comming soon
    Session - IV

    Working with Forms

    Data passing between the Pages using a FORM
    Lab Ex1: Using Form Submission with POST method
    Lab Ex2: Using Form Submission with GET method
    Data Passing between the Pages using Query String /Hidden Variable
    Lab Ex3: Using Query String with A link.
    Lab Ex4: Using Hidden variable with a form.
    Session - V

    Sessions and Cookies

    Session Declaration, Storing/Retrieving data into/from a Session
    Lab Ex5: For Storing, Retrieving and delete data from a session
    Lab Ex6: For Data passing between the pages with session objects Cookies Declaration,Storing/Retrieving data into/from a Cookie
    Lab Ex7: For Storing, Retrieving and delete data from Cookie
    Ex8 For Data passing between the pages with Cookie objects.
    Session - VI

    Working with File Systems

    Working with Files
    Lab Ex1 For Reading/Writing data from/into a file
    Lab Ex2 For Reading data from a file and process with string functions Working with Folders
    Lab Ex3 For Reading files from a folder and copy into another folder
    MySql
    Introduction, Database Management
    Lab Ex1 For Database Management from MySQL prompt
    Lab Ex2 For Database Management from PhpMyAdmin
    Session – VII

    MySql Table Interation

    Working with Tables –SQL Queries
    Lab Ex3 For Running SQL commands for Insert/Update/Delete data from a Table
    Lab Ex4 For Running SQL commands for Retrieving data from a Table
    Working with Join Queries
    Database Administration with PHPMyAdmin
    Lab Ex5 For Running SQL commands for Retrieving data from More than one Table
    Session - VIII

    MySql Interaction from PHP

    Retrieving Data from a table using PHP
    Lab Ex1 For displaying all Students info into a list page from a table
    Lab Ex2 For displaying all Students info into a list page based on user search criteria
    Inserting Data from PHP Page to a tables
    Lab Ex3 For Pushing Student information into db tables using PHP Updating Data from PHP Page to a tables
    Lab Ex4 For updating Existing Student Information into db tables using PHP
    Insert/Update Table information in a single page
    Lab Ex5 For inserting/updating Student Information into db tables using PHP from a single page
    Lab Ex6 For Student Information inserting into db tables using PHP session objects
    Session - IX

    AJAX.

    Introduction & Architecture
    Implementation
    Lab Ex1 For getting dynamic data into specified locations of the page.
    Lab Ex2 For dynamic data loading into a list box. Html : HTML HOME
    HTML Introduction
    HTML Basic
    HTML Elements
    HTML Attributes
    HTML Headings
    HTML Paragraphs
    HTML Formatting
    HTML Styles
    HTML Links
    HTML Tables
    HTML Images
    HTML Lists
    HTML Forms
    HTML Frames
    HTML I frames
    HTML Colors
    HTML Color names
    HTML Color values
    HTML Quick List
    HTML Advanced
    HTML Do types
    HTML CSS
    HTML Head
    HTML Meta
    HTML Scripts
    HTML Entities
    HTML URLs
    HTML URL Encode
    HTML Web server
    CSS : CSS HOME
    CSS Introduction
    CSS Syntax
    CSS Id & Class
    CSS How To
    CSS Styling
    Styling Backgrounds
    Styling Text
    Styling Fonts
    Styling Links
    Styling Lists
    Styling Tables
    CSS Box Model
    CSS Box Model
    CSS Border
    CSS Outline
    CSS Margin
    CSS Padding
    CSS Advanced
    CSS Grouping/Nesting
    CSS Dimension
    CSS Display
    CSS Positioning
    CSS Floating
    CSS Align
    CSS Pseudo-class
    CSS Pseudo-element
    CSS Navigation Bar
    CSS Image Gallery
    CSS Image Opacity
    CSS Image Sprites
    CSS Media Types
    CSS Attribute Selectors
    JavaScript : Js basic
    JS HOME
    JS Introduction
    JS How To
    JS Where To
    JS Statements
    JS Comments
    JS Variables
    JS Operators
    JS Comparisons
    JS If...Else
    JS Switch
    JS Popup Boxes
    JS Functions
    JS For Loop
    JS While Loop
    JS Break Loops
    JS For...In
    JS Events
    JS Try...Catch
    JS Throw
    JS Special Text
    JS Guidelines
    Js Objects
    JS Objects Intro
    JS String
    JS Date
    JS Array
    JS Boolean
    JS Math
    JS Reg Exp
    JS Advanced
    JS Browser
    JS Cookies
    JS Validation
    JS Timing
    JS Create Object
    Joomla
    Introduction
    Joomla 1.5 Installation
    2: Global Configuration

    • Content

    Site settings
    Linked Titles
    Read More Link
    Item Rating/Voting
    Author Names
    Created Date and Time
    Modified Date and Time
    Hits
    Icons
    Table of Contents
    Content Item Navigation
    Server
    Default Metadata
    Mail
    Caching
    Statistics
    Advanced Media manager
    Creating image directories/folders
    Uploading and deleting images
    Modifying images/resizing
    Module Positions and site layout
    Template Manager
    Installing templates
    Setting the default template
    Using multiple templates
    Trash manager - permanently deleting menu and content items
    User administration
    creating users
    editing users
    blocking users
    setting access levels
    deleting users
    Components
    Configuring and installing components
    Sef (search engine friendly) component administration
    JCE Text Editor configuration.
    Rsform and philaform (form components)
    Mass mail
    Web links
    Banner manager
    Guestbook
    Site Modules
    Installing Modules
    Module Order
    Custom Modules
    Component modules
    Access Level
    Parameters
    Site Mambots
    Installing Mambots
    Parameters
    Site Content
    Creating, and editing content items/pages
    Static Content Pages
    Publishing and unpublishing content/pages
    Setting access levels for content/pages
    Inserting images into pages
    Content/page parameters
    Meta tag and meta keyword information
    Adding menu links
    Frontpage manager
    Newslflash items
    Inserting a Google maps
    System
    Configuring Joomla templates in dreamweaver or your ftp program
    Hands on use of Joomla to ensure you know how to control the admin section and create and edit content.
    Drupal(CMS)
    Lesson 1: Getting Started with Drupal
    Introducing Drupal
    Drupal Speak
    What Does Drupal Need to Work?
    Downloading Drupal
    Downloading and installing Acquia Drupal
    Lesson 2: Welcome to your new Acquia Drupal website!
    The Administration Menu
    The Administration menu - Content Management
    The Administration menu - Content Management & Site Building
    The Administration menu - Site Configuration
    String and Date Functions
    Working with String/Date Functions
    Lab Ex7: For String functions like substr (), strops, strlen and explode
    Administration menu - User Management
    The Administration menu - Reports
    Things to do
    Lesson 3: Project
    Solution to lesson 2 tasks
    Introduction & Aims
    Taken project- Project Brief
    Solution
    Modules for the project site
    Lesson 4: Modules & Content Types
    Modules for the project site
    Finding and assessing modules
    Content Types and CCK
    Building the news content type 1
    Building the news content type 2
    Building the News Content Type 3
    Building the News Content Type 4
    Installing a WYSIWYG Editor
    Using the Image Cache Module
    Lesson 5: Calendars, Blocks & Menus
    The Events Content Type
    Drupal's Blocks
    Menus 1
    Menus 2
    Lesson 6: Themes & More User Interaction
    Theming the Site
    Building the Site Forum
    The Contact Forms
    Setting up a Site Newsletter
    Roles & Permissions
    Roles & Permissions 2
    Wordpress(CMS)
    Introduction to wordpress
    Wordpress Installation
    Working with post, media, pages, comments
    Working with appearance, user, tools, setting
    Working with plugin in Wordpress website
    Using external plugin in wordpress website
    Working with widgets in Wordpress
    Converting HTML template to Wordpress theme
    CRUD operation using database in Wordpress
    Creating user defined plugins in Wordpress
    Creating user defined widgets in Wordpress
    Prestashop(CMS)
    Introduction to Prestashop
    Prestashop Installation
    Working with post, media, pages, comments
    Working with appearance, user, tools, setting
    Working with plugin in Prestashop website
    Using external plugin in Prestashop website
    Working with widgets in Prestashop
    Converting HTML template to Prestashop theme
    CRUD operation using database in Prestashop
    Creating user defined plugins in Prestashop
    Creating user defined widgets in Prestashop
  • comming soon
    comming soon
  • comming soon
    comming soon
  • coming soon content
    coming soon content / Robotics With ARM


Other Offerings